Actress Park Shin Hye of the upcoming historical film 'The Royal Tailor' shared her tips on filming crying scenes. Today, the press release of the film 'The Royal Tailor' took place. Actress Park Shin Hye during an interview said, "I tried to portray the sad feelings of the queen, my character, who is not loved by the king and always alone in the big palace." She said on filming crying scenes, "I had to cry a lot, but tried not to frown much because some people don't like to see that." She added, "I become ugly when I cry." In related news, the historical film 'The Royal Tailor' premieres on December 24 in Korea. It tells a story of the tailors who designed clothes for the royal families in the Cho Sun dynasty of Korea. Star actors and actresses, such as actress Park Shin Hye, actor Han Suk Kyoo, actor Ko Soo, actor Yoo Yeon Suk and actor Ma Dong Suk, are to star in the film. Actress Park Shin Hye is to play the sad queen, and actor Yoo Yeon Suk will play the lonely king who longs for the perfect love in 'The Royal Tailor.'
